Little Rocks

  • Ages: 8 - 11
  • Dates: Sundays from 9:00 – 11:00 October 22, 2023, through March 17, 2024.

This is a fun and fabulous fall and winter program for children; Many of Canada’s elite curlers had their start in a Little Rocks program!

We use lighter rocks (20 pounds versus 40 pounds) which makes it easier to learn the fundamentals at a young age. Focus will be on learning the basics of curling including delivery, sweeping, rules, and strategy in a safe and enjoyable atmosphere.  Many of our instructors are trained and certified by Curling Ontario.

  • Required Equipment: Head protection, clean shoes, and warm clothing.
  • Optional Equipment: Broom, Curling Shoes (Club can provide brooms and step-on sliders for new curlers)

Bantam Youth Development

  • Ages: 12 - 18
  • Dates: Sundays from 11:30 – 1:30 October 22, 2023, through March 17, 2024.

We welcome both new and experienced curlers into this program. For new curlers, we teach them the basics, with a focus on correct delivery, effective sweeping, curling rules and etiquette, and strategy, and then move them forward as they gain experience.

For experienced Bantam curlers, we work on the finer points of the game, encouraging them to improve and grow. Often, they will form teams and go to bonspiels. Granite rocks are used in the Bantam program.

  • Required Equipment: Head protection, clean shoes, and warm clothing.
  • Optional Equipment: Broom, Curling Shoes (Club can provide brooms and step-on sliders for new curlers)
